ctfmon

ctfmon

ctfmon是公用追蹤設備監視器的簡稱,控制Alternative User Input Text Processor (TIP)和Microsoft Office語言條。Ctfmon.exe提供語音識別、手寫識別、鍵盤、翻譯和其它用戶輸入技術的支持。

進程信息


進程:ctfmon、 ctfmon.exe
進程文件:ctfmon or ctfmon.exe
全稱:Common Trace Facility Monitor(公用追蹤設備監視器)
進程名稱:Alternative User Input Services
出品者:Microsoft Corp.
屬於:Microsoft Office Suite
系統進程:是
後台程序:是
使用網路:否
硬體相關:否
常見錯誤:未知N/A
常見錯誤:未知N/A
安全等級(0-5):0(0最安全,5最危險)
間諜軟體:否
廣告軟體:否
病毒:否
木馬:否

禁用方法


CTFMON.EXE是Office自動載入的文字服務,安裝Office XP后,部分輸入法變得非常難用,卸載Office XP后,它在控制面板中生成的文字服務仍然存在,任務欄中的輸入法也沒有恢復。目前,禁止文字服務自動載入的常用方法有三種:
1.從系統配置實用程序(msconfig.exe)里移除CTFMON.EXE,這個方法並不能真正禁用文字服務,因為當啟動Office程序時,文字服務還會自動載入。
2.在“開始→運行”中鍵入“regedit.exe”,打開“註冊表編輯器”,展開分支“H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Run”,將ctfmon鍵值刪除即可。
3.以Windows XP為例介紹第三種方法的操作步驟:首先退出所有的Office 程序,進入“控制面板→添加/刪除程序”,選擇“Microsoft Office XP”項,點擊“更改”;在維護模式對話框里選擇“添加或刪除功能”,然後點擊“下一步”;展開“Office共享功能”,點擊“中文可選用戶輸入方法”項,選擇“不安裝”,點擊“更新”;然後進入“控制面板→區域和語言選項”,進入“語言”選項卡,點擊“詳細信息”,在已安裝服務列表中,將除英語(美國)之外的其他輸入法一一刪除;最後點擊“開始→運行”,鍵入“Regsvr32.exe /U msimtf.dll”註銷Msimtf.dll,接著鍵入“Regsvr32.exe /U Msctf.dll”註銷Msctf.dll。這種方法效果不錯,但是操作太繁瑣。

程序代碼


1. 程序代碼如下:
#include
int APIENTRY WinMain( HINSTANCE, HINSTANCE, LPTSTR, int )
{
HANDLE m_hMutex = CreateMutex( NULL, TRUE, "ctfmon.exe" );
if( GetLastError() != ERROR_ALREADY_EXISTS )
while ( 1 ) Sleep( INFINITE );
return 0;
}
2. 如果執行后發現word的輸入法無法正確使用,解決辦法如下:
第一步:打開word
第二步:點擊“工具”菜單中的“選項”子菜單。點擊“編輯”選項卡。
第三步:清除“輸入法控制處於活動狀態”的複選。點擊“確定”
第四步:點擊“工具”菜單中“語言”子菜單中的“設置語言”項。
第五步:在列表中選擇“英語 美國”,點擊確定。
第六步:關閉Word,重起計算機。

解決


如果你發現你的輸入法圖標不見了。你可以試著做以下方法:
打開我的電腦
1、打開C盤
2、打開windows
3、找到system32文件並打開它
4、找ctfmon雙擊就出來了。
一。右擊任務欄空白處-工具欄-語言欄即可。
二。首先打開文字服務
1. 單擊開始,單擊 控制面板,然後雙擊“區域和語言選項”。
2. 在語言選項卡上的“文字服務和輸入語言”下,單擊詳細信息。
3. 在首選項下,單擊語言欄。
4,選擇“關閉高級文字服務”複選框,,把裡面的鉤去掉.
三。其次設置語言欄的輸入法
1. 單擊開始,單擊控制面板,然後雙擊“區域和語言選項”。
2. 在語言選項卡上,在“文字服務和輸入語言”下,單擊詳細信息。
3. 在首選項下,單擊語言欄。
4. 選擇“在桌面上顯示語言欄”複選框。
如果您安裝了文字服務,語言欄將自動顯示。但是,如果您關閉了語言欄,您可以使用此步驟重新顯示它。
如果要將語言欄最小化到任務欄,右擊任務欄上的語言圖標,然後單擊“設置",選擇你要用的輸入法添加就是了。
任務欄→右擊→工具欄→單擊“語言欄”
如果任務欄中沒語言欄了,就先
開始→運行→輸入→ctfmon→確定,這樣就有了。
如果還沒的話,那麼你就到別人的機子上拷貝個ctfmon.exe文件到你的電腦上就好了,也可以從網上下載一個。注意:這是個隱藏文件。

安全


如果你懷疑此進程有些不正常,那麼我們用下面的一些方法快速的察覺出Ctfmon.exe相關的病毒:
1、如果發現Ctfmon.exe不在System32目錄下;
2、如果此進程發現佔用資源太多;
3、如果Win7系統運行了Ctfmon.exe;
若發現情況建議馬上更新殺毒軟體最新病毒庫並對電腦全盤掃描。